 Facts
 

Headphones are used by a range of portable devices such as cd, cassette and mp3 players. However they were first designed for hifi-systems, so people could listen privately to music without disturbing people in the same room. The technlogy has advanced greatly with wireless infra-red headphones becoming common, and the majority of portable headphones including a remote control with basic play, pause, stop, forward and rewind functions.

Summary of Headphones

You can find Technics, Philips and Sony stereo headphones such as the Technics full sized closed back headphones with XBS port, boasts low frequencies, 40mm drive unit, 3.5mm gold plated stereo plug and 4m cord. You can also find the Sony horizontal headphones with Sony acoustic twin turbo circuit for deep bass sound, horizontal headband and 1.5 metre cord. The Philips infra red stereo headphones include a self adjusting inner headband, single volume control, built-in recharge circuit, rechargeable batteries and up to 7 metre effective reception range.
